(Cartagena de Indias, Exclusive SoloAzar) - Guillermo Ruipérez, head of sales at R. Franco Digital, in an exclusive conversation with SoloAzar, emphasised the special focus on organisation and networking during the 25th edition of GAT EXPO. He highlighted the wide range of the integral products and services offered by the firm, as well as the international character of the event that consolidates it as an essential regional meeting point.

"The 25th edition of GAT has stood out for its special attention to organisation and networking in Latin America," said Guillermo Ruipérez, head of sales at R. Franco Digital

Then, he took the opportunity to make a personal observation about the event, where he highlighted that, although the fair has experienced some retraction in terms of exposure, especially in its online aspect, he clarifies that "for R. Franco Digital this is not a drawback since our offer is 360° for the industry, such as localised gaming, en route, PAM, online games, sportsbook, lottery, among others". In terms of networking, Guillermo notes an increase in international connections, making the event a meeting point for players in the region.

Regarding the programme and R. Franco Digital's participation in the conferences, Guillermo commented that the programme was engaging and well-structured, with short sessions offering a wide range of knowledge. “I had the opportunity to attend some of the conferences with a focus on other markets, and I found them really interesting.”

The sales manager also reflected on what happened at some of the conferences he attended: “There were some tense moments between the speakers, defending their positions, which is always positive.”

“We always discover new developments that are relevant to R. Franco Digital", underlined Guillermo and added that new types of games are gaining ground, as well as the differences in marketing management in different countries.

"For the upcoming events, R. Franco Digital plans to participate in various international conferences, such as Sigma Sao Paulo, Fijma Madrid, the Ibero-American Gaming Summit and iGB Amsterdam," shared Guillermo, and emphasised the firm's commitment to be present at major industry events worldwide.
